Ange Postecoglou angry with reporter! 'You may be a lost cause'

Nottingham Forest manager Ange Postecoglou lashed out at a reporter who asked him a question at the press conference after the 2-0 loss to Newcastle United.

Ange Postecoglou angry with reporter! 'You may be a lost cause'

Nottingham Forest, one of the Premier League teams, continues to go downhill. Forest, who recently replaced Nuno Espirito Santo with Ange Postecoglou, failed to get the results they wanted again.

Postecoglou responded to a reporter's question 'Do you think things will improve?' after the 2-0 loss to Newcastle United and unexpectedly lashed out at the reporter.

'LOST CAUSE'

Responding sarcastically to the reporter, Postecoglou said: 'No, this is a hopeless case. Seriously, what's wrong with something being difficult? I'm sure your (the reporter's) parents also had difficulties in life, didn't they? And they didn't give up... At one point you could have been a hopeless case, but they didn't give up on you, did they?

Under the 60-year-old manager, Forest have played 7 official matches, losing 5 and drawing 2, averaging 0.29 points.
